Overview of our role The Delivery Lead - Integration, is a key senior role within Jemena’s Integration & Automation team, guiding the smooth and successful delivery of integration solutions across our Digital project portfolio and BAU work. Lead resource and workforce planning and allocation onto projects, and contractor coordination. Support and uplift a team of external engineers, helping them plan, design, and deliver projects that move our technology strategy forward. In this role, you’ll help shape how we plan, resource, and deliver integration and automation work by partnering closely with project teams and our Principal Engineers. Your focus will be on creating clarity, building strong relationships, and championing high-quality engineering outcomes. You’ll play an important part in: Leading and supporting the team across a mix of meaningful projects, ensuring work is delivered to a high standard. Planning and coordinating resources , working with project managers to understand demand and ensure teams are well-supported. Embedding best-practice engineering, partnering with Principal Engineers to uphold standards and grow capability. Driving continuous improvement across integration platforms, processes, and BAU initiatives. Ensuring operational needs are met, so that project changes land smoothly and sustainably. This role is central to keeping our integration and automation work thoughtful, well-planned, and closely aligned to Jemena’s broader goals. Your leadership will help create a supportive, collaborative environment where high-quality engineering thrives. A little about you Strong strategic planning skills, including resource roadmaps aligned to project needs. Lead resource and workforce planning, and contractor coordination Proven ability to plan and manage contingent engineering resources. Experience leading and resource planning of technical teams to deliver integration solutions across APIs, file transfer, events, and streaming. Solid grounding in quality and security engineering practices (code reviews, version control, automation). Background delivering in complex hybrid environments across on-prem and cloud (AWS/Azure).
